Rotherham missed two penalties in their first victory since New Year's Eve. Brett Pitman hit the post for the Cherries in the first half, before Martin Butler struck on 58 minutes, heading home unchallenged.
Lee Williamson added the second as he kept his nerve to slot home following a pass from Michael Keane.
Butler then pushed his penalty past the post on 82 minutes and in injury time Paul Hurst missed a second spot-kick when he struck the crossbar.
